I think of this battle because of The Last of the Mohicans. The British made a noble stand, but they had to surrender the fort. Montcalm tries to make the Indian allies observe the terms of surrender, the chiefs of various tribes listened, and felt betrayed. Many warriors died fighting alongside the French, and expected to return home with the honours of war. In the film version, Montcalm gives Magua the go ahead to attack the British marching. In reality, the British begin to leave. Escorted by French grenadiers. Trailing the Redcoats, is a long disorganized line of American provincials and camp followers. As the column comes upon a clearing outside the fort, the Indians begin their attack. It lasts only a few minutes. When it was over, exaggerated reports of 1,500 dead fueled anger among New England colonists. The truth was that 75 were killed. Of the 500 taken captive, many are ransomed back within a few days. What should have been a great victory, leaves Canada in peril. Without their Indian allies, the French will lose the war for North America.

I would argue that the French and Indian War was almost entirely a different conflict due to the ways of engagement that often confused commanders who were unused to fighting in the colonies and the extensive use of Native American Auxiliaries. Most European historians agree that it was part of the Seven Years War, but since armed hostilities commenced two years earlier than the declaration of War in 1756, I would classify it as a cause of the Seven Years War, although not the sole cause.

Braddock was racist to the Scouts (Often calling them things such as 'Damned Natives') and was generally disrespectful to their culture so many Native Americans just left, meaning he had a crippling lack of those essential scouts and Native Flankers who knew the environment better than him. Eventually, this callous disregard would prove fatal for him.
